Originally released in 1979. Almost Transparent Blue is a feature film. directed by Ryū Murakami.

Starring Kunihiko Mitamura, Mari Nakayama, and Haruhiko Saito

Synopsis

In the mid-1970s, a small group of friends are living in a Japanese town near an American air force base, their lives revolve around sex, drugs and rock 'n roll. The near-plotless story weaves a vividly raw, image-intensive journey through the daily monotony of drug-induced hallucinations, vicious acts of violence, overdoses, suicide, and group sex.
